Waterproof cement is uniquely formulated to prevent water ingress, making it an ideal choice for construction projects in high-humidity environments. Its water-resistant properties improve the durability of walls, foundations, and floors, preventing damage from mold growth, cracking, or erosion. Traditional construction cement often struggles under constant exposure to moisture, which can compromise structural integrity over time. By contrast, waterproof cement provides superior strength and reliability, eliminating many common water-related issues. Additionally, its moisture resistance makes it a strong candidate for specialized applications like swimming pools, water tanks, bathrooms, and basements. The versatility of waterproof cement ensures its relevance in both residential and large-scale commercial projects.
The key difference between waterproof cement and regular construction cement lies in the additives used in the mixture. Waterproof cement is engineered with compounds such as hydrophobic materials and water-repellent chemicals that integrate seamlessly into the base cement. These additives act as a barrier, reducing water penetration and extending the lifespan of structures. Traditional cement, though effective for general-purpose applications, lacks these specialized properties, making it less suitable for environments prone to moisture or water exposure. Additionally, waterproof cement’s superior bonding capabilities help prevent cracks and leaks, which are common vulnerabilities of standard cement mortar. Using waterproof cement supplies ensures higher performance and requires less frequent maintenance compared to opting for traditional solutions.
Proper application techniques are critical to achieving the desired waterproofing results. When using waterproof cement, ensuring a clean and properly prepared surface is essential for maximum adhesion. Cracks and imperfections in the substrate must be filled and leveled before application. Mixing waterproof cement in the correct ratio with water is equally important, as improper proportions can weaken its water-repellent properties. Builders often combine waterproof cement with other advanced additives, such as redispersible polymer powder or VAE powder, to further enhance its bonding and flexibility.
